It does not have to be perfect. I think this is the best lesson that I have learned and experienced so far during my art classes. Amazing things can happen when you do not cling to the idea that the end result should be beautiful or perfect or exactly like you intended from the start. Maybe during the process you do something which creates an interesting composition or image even though it was not what you intended to do. Why not go with that?   My teacher told us that it is better not to focus on making a pretty picture. Make something ugly.
